<strong>English</strong><br />Pati includes the prospective regencies for accelerating the growth rate and area diversification of shallot production in Central Java. However, the shallot production and productivity in Pati were unstable with a decreasing trend in recent years. The objective of this study is to evaluate the status and determinants of the shallot production efficiency using the Cobb-Douglas stochastic frontier production function. The research was conducted in three production centers sub-districts, Wedarijaksa, Batangan, and Jaken, in October 2017. The primary data were collected by interviewing 33 respondents which were selected through the stratified sampling technique. The results indicated that shallot farmers were efficient technically, but not economically and allocatively. Two significant determinants of the technical efficiency were the length of farming experience (positively related) and farmers’ age (negatively related). The farmers group membership and access to extension services were not significant, but both have positive effects on technical efficiency. Production efficiency may be increased through inputs use optimization that include reducing of anorganic fertilizer, increasing the quantity of organic fertilizer and seed, using of the true shallot seed and implementation of Integrated Pest Management. Improving the functions of agriculture extentions and farmers’ groups should also enhance shallot farming efficiency.<br /><br /><br /><strong>Indonesian</strong><br />Kabupaten Pati termasuk kabupaten di Jawa Tengah yang dipandang prospektif untuk percepatan peningkatan dan diversifikasi wilayah produksi bawang merah. The Internet is considered to be an important factor in accelerating economic growth. There is a statistic regarding the inline of higher economic growth with higher Internet access. However, the impact of the Internet on agriculture as a real sector regarding its contribution on economic growth has not been explored in detail. The purpose of this study is to analyze the global effect of the Internet on agricultural sector performance. Static panel regression was used in this study by involving 126 countries using data from World Bank Open Data (2012–2019). Extended analysis was employed by applying the regression into two classifications, namely, countries by continent and the country composition of World Economic Outlook (WEO) groups. The result of this study shows that there exists a positive and significant global effect from Internet users, fixed broadband subscriptions, and secure Internet servers on agricultural sector performance. Additionally, the positive effect of Internet variables on agriculture was only found in Africa, Asia, and Oceania. In the country composition of WEO groups, there existed a positive and significant effect of Internet users and fixed broadband subscriptions on agricultural sector performance in economies classified as emerging and developing. This implies that the role of the Internet on agriculture is relatively higher in developing countries. Therefore, policymakers in Africa, Asia, Oceania, and emerging and developing economies (WEO Groups) must consider the role of Internet to improve agricultural sectors.

This cross sectional study aimed to analyse influence of attitude, subjective norm, demography, sosioeconomic and shariah and conventional financial literacy toward entrepreneurship intention among college students. Refers to the model of Theory of Reasoned Action developed by Fishbein dan Ajzen, behavioral intentions are a function of attitude toward behavior and the subjective norm (Sumarwan 2011). Respondents were 100 college students selected by convenience sampling methods. Data collection was purposively conducted at public universities located in Jakarta, Bogor, Depok and Tangerang on February 2016 until August 2016. Interview was conducted using reliable and valid questionnaire as a tool. Descriptive analysis on attitude toward entrepreneurship showed that respondents strongly agreed with the attitude statement and subjective norm indicates that they disagree with recommendation from nearest person to start a business. In addition, analysis of the entrepreneurship intention showed that respondents have an interest to become entrepreneur. Regression analysis with dummy variable showed that entrepreneurship intention was significantly affected by variables of attitude toward entrepreneurship and conventional financial literacy (p value <0.05), gender (women tend to be more interested in entrepreneurship as compared to men), experience of taking entrepreneurship class and experience of being entrepreneur (p value <0.10). To increase student's entrepreneurship intention, it needs efforts from various parties, especially from academics to build attitude toward entrepreneurship and to increase financial literacy among students. Indonesia has been still experiencing regional economic disparity problems, including in labour productivity. This study employs dynamic panel approach to analyze convergence and to identify determinants of regional labour productivity during the period of 1987-2011. The System Generalized Method of Moments (Sys-GMM) estimation results show that regional convergence process occurs with speed of convergence of 0.06518 per year. Physical capital stock, human capital stock, total trade, and real wage give positive impacts. The objectives of this research were to analyze consumer's perception of marketing mix, to analyze the effects of marketing mix towards purchase decision, and to formulate strategies to increase consumer purchases at Furnimart Bogor. The data retrieval technique was conducted using in-depth interviews to key persons in Furnimart, consumers and obtaining data from the previous research. There were 13 variables used in this study with 120 samples chosen at random. The data were processed using descriptive analysis and Structural Equation Modelling (SEM), through LISREL 8.72. The results of the research showed that consumer perception on the marketing mix consisting of product, price, place and promotion stated that 75.83% of consumers rated the product design as good, 60.5%t competitive price, and 75.63% said that Furnimart store location was easy to reach and offered attractive promotion.
